//! The Phi eXtension Binary wire protocol — a Rust port of `ext/go/pxb`.
//!
//! # Frame
//!
//! Every message is one length-prefixed binary frame on a duplex byte stream
//! (typically a child process stdin/stdout). No JSON, no newlines.
//!
//! ```text
//! ┌──────── header (16 bytes, little-endian) ────────┐
//! │ magic[4]="PXB\x01" │ typ u16 │ flags u16 │ id u32│
//! │ payload_len u32                                  │
//! └──────────────────────────────────────────────────┘
//! │ payload: tagged fields                           │
//! ```
//!
//! # Evolution rules
//!
//! 1. New message fields: allocate a new tag (≥1). Never reuse a tag.
//! 2. New lifecycle events: allocate a new `Ev*` code. Never reuse a code.
//! 3. New frame types: allocate a `Type*` in the Ext→Host (1–99) or
//!    Host→Ext (100–199) range; peers skip unknown types by length.
//! 4. Incompatible renames / semantic breaks: bump
//!    [`PROTOCOL_VERSION`](crate::pxb::PROTOCOL_VERSION) and refuse old peers.
//! 5. Experimental tags use 128+ and must remain skippable.
//!
//! These rules keep host and extension binaries independently upgradable
//! without a shared JSON schema or lockstep release.
